SECTION 5-11 523) Use the Texas Instrument website to look up the 74ALS74A DFF. (a)* How long can it take for the Q output of a 74ALS74A to switch from 0 to 1 in response to an active CLK transition? (b)* How long does the D input need to be stable before the active clock edge on the 74ALS74A? (c) What is the narrowest pulse that can be applied to the PRE of a 74ALS74A FF? Use the Texas Instrument website to look up the 74ALS112A DFF. (a) How long does it typically take to asynchronously clear a 74ALS112? (b) How long maximum does it take to asynchronously set a 74ALS112? (c) What is the shortest acceptable interval between active clock transitions for a 74ALS74A? (d) The Jinput of a 74ALS112A goes HIGH 15 ns before the active clock edge. The K input has been at O. Will the flip-flop be reliably set? (e) How long does it take (after the clock edge) to synchronously store a 1 in a cleared 74ALS74A D flip-flop?Explanation / Answer
23.a. The corresponding parameter is tPLH mentioned in "switching characteristics" in page 4 in the datasheet
5ns < tPLH < 16ns
b. The corresponding parameter is tsu mentioned in "recommended operating conditions" in page 3 in the datasheet
tsu = 15ns
c. The corresponding parameter is tw mentioned in "recommended operating conditions" in page 4 in the datasheet
tw = 4ns.
24. a. tw for CLR is min 10ns. So it takes min of 10ns to asynchronously clear.
b. tw for PRE is min 10ns. So it takes min of 10ns to asynchronously set
c. The max frequency of operation is 30MHz which means the shortest interval between 2 active clock edges is is the time period = 1/fmax. ie Tmin = 1/(30e6) = 33.33ns.
d. The set up time tsu is 22ns. So the J input should appear at least 22ns before the active clock edge. So in this case since it appears only 15ns earlier, it is a setup violation and thus the flip flop wont be reliably set.
